Transaction 7fbb1558348928164b6a1ae44d9be44f193ceb1347e2a9e0759fd654fc223cf3
1 Input
1 Output
-
7fbb1558348928164b6a1ae44d9be44f193ceb1347e2a9e0759fd654fc223cf3:0
- value
- 788188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0681e8dadceefff751a7774034f4320d48229272 OP_EQUAL
- address
- 32HRbyHaWpUxU9Edc6V4ZLJraPwcYehAEG